نمونه فایل سیستم جدول قرعهکشی در اکسل (با ماکرو VBA)
برای دانلود اینجا کلیک فرمایید (نمونه فایل سیستم جدول قرعهکشی در اکسل (با ماکرو VBA))
سیستم قرعه کشی در اکسل , دانلود سورس کد قرعه کشی , قرعه کشی با VBA , تولید بلیط در اکسل , انتخاب برنده در اکسل , ماکرو VBA قرعه کشی , پروژه قرعه کشی اکسل , کد آماده اکسل قرعه کشی , دانلود پروژه VBA , سورس کد اکسل پیشرفته , خروجی PDF اکسل ,

نمونه فایل سیستم جدول قرعهکشی در اکسل (با ماکرو VBA)
در دنیای امروز، بسیاری از سازمانها، شرکتها و حتی افراد، نیاز دارند تا فرآیندهای قرعهکشی و انتخاب تصادفی را به صورت منظم، سریع و قابل اطمینان انجام دهند. یکی از بهترین ابزارها برای این منظور، نرمافزار اکسل است که با قابلیتهای گستردهاش، میتواند این نیازها را برآورده کند. اما وقتی صحبت از قرعهکشیهای پیچیدهتر میشود، نیاز به برنامهنویسی و نوشتن ماکروهای VBA پیدا میشود تا فرآیندهای دستی و زمانبر را خودکار و دقیق سازد. در این مقاله، قصد داریم به طور کامل و جامع درباره نمونه فایل سیستم جدول قرعهکشی در اکسل، با استفاده از ماکرو VBA، توضیح دهیم و تمامی جزئیات مربوط به آن را بررسی کنیم.
پروسه طراحی این سیستم، ابتدا با درک نیازهای کاربر شروع میشود. فرض کنیم کاربر میخواهد یک لیست شرکتکنندگان داشته باشد و سپس به صورت تصادفی، برندگان را انتخاب کند. این فرآیند باید قابل تکرار باشد، نتایج قابل اعتماد، و در عین حال، کاربر بتواند به راحتی آن را اجرا کند. برای این منظور، ابتدا باید یک فایل اکسل طراحی کنیم که شامل چند بخش اصلی باشد: لیست شرکتکنندگان، دکمههای کنترل، و نتایج قرعهکشی.
در مرحله اول، یک شیت جدید ایجاد میکنیم و عنوانهایی مانند "لیست شرکتکنندگان"، "نتایج" و "دکمههای کنترل" را قرار میدهیم. در بخش "لیست شرکتکنندگان"، کاربر نام افراد را وارد میکند. این لیست باید به صورت ستون در یک ناحیه مشخص قرار گیرد، مثلا ستون A، و تعداد شرکتکنندگان هر روز میتواند متغیر باشد. نکته مهم این است که این لیست باید به صورت منظم و بدون خطا وارد شود، چون ماکرو بر اساس این دادهها عمل میکند.
در بخش "دکمههای کنترل"، دکمههایی طراحی میشود که وظیفه شروع قرعهکشی، ریست کردن لیست، و نمایش نتایج را بر عهده دارند. این دکمهها با استفاده از ابزار فرم کنترل در اکسل ساخته میشوند، و هر کدام به یک ماکرو VBA مربوط میشوند. برای مثال، دکمه "شروع قرعهکشی" با کلیک کاربر، تابعی را اجرا میکند که در آن فرآیند انتخاب تصادفی برندگان انجام میشود.
حالا، در بخش کد نویسی VBA، باید به دقت برنامهریزی کنیم. ابتدا، باید تابعی برای انتخاب تصادفی برندهها بنویسیم. این تابع، تعداد برندگان را از کاربر دریافت میکند، سپس به صورت تصادفی، افراد را از لیست انتخاب مینماید. برای این کار، معمولاً از تابع تصادفی Rnd در VBA استفاده میشود، همراه با توابعی مانند Randomize برای تضمین تصادفی بودن نتایج.
در داخل کد، ابتدا تعداد برندگان را … ← ادامه مطلب در magicfile.ir
یک فایل در موضوع (نمونه فایل سیستم جدول قرعهکشی در اکسل (با ماکرو VBA)) آماده کرده ایم که از لینک زیر می توانید دانلود فرمایید برای دانلود کردن به لینک زیر بروید
منبع : https://magicfile.ir
